ホームページ >バックエンド開発 >PHPの問題 >PHPのバージョンを変更する方法

PHPのバージョンを変更する方法

PHPz
PHPzオリジナル
2023-04-21 09:11:102341ブラウズ

PHP は Web プログラミング言語として、Web サイトを構築するプロセスにおいて非常に重要な役割を果たします。ただし、さまざまな理由 (特定のサードパーティ ソフトウェアの要件など) により、PHP バージョンの変更が必要になる場合があります。

それでは、PHP のバージョンを変更するにはどうすればよいでしょうか?次にこれについて詳しく説明しましょう。

  1. 現在の PHP バージョンを確認する

PHP バージョンを変更する前に、現在のシステムの PHP バージョンを確認する必要があります。次の方法で確認できます。

1.1 PHP コマンド ラインを使用します。

コマンド ラインに次のコマンドを入力します。

php -v

実行後、現在のシステムは次のようになります。 PHPのバージョン情報が表示されます。

1.2 phpinfo() の表示

次の内容を含む phpinfo.php ファイルを Web サイトのルート ディレクトリに作成します。

<?php
phpinfo();
?>

ファイルを開くと、「Currently installs」と表示されます。 PHPのバージョン情報と設定情報。

  1. 必要な PHP バージョンを見つける

PHP バージョンを変更する前に、まず必要な PHP バージョンを見つける必要があります。ここでは 2 つの検索方法を示します。

2.1 Google 検索エンジンを使用する

Google 検索エンジンに「php バージョン番号 ダウンロード」と入力します (例: 「php 7.0.0 ダウンロード」)。対応するダウンロードリンク。

2.2 公式 Web サイトからのダウンロード

PHP のさまざまなバージョンは、PHP 公式 Web サイト (http://www.php.net/downloads.php) で見つけることができます。

  1. PHP バージョンの切り替え

必要な PHP バージョンが見つかったら、バージョンの切り替えを開始できます。以下に 3 つの切り替え方法を紹介します。

3.1 コマンド ラインを使用して変更する

コマンド ラインに次のコマンドを入力します。

update-alternatives --config php

実行後、使用可能なすべてのオプションが表示されます。現在のシステムの PHP バージョンのリストが表示されます。プロンプトに従って目的のバージョンを選択し、バージョンの切り替えを完了します。

3.2 Apache モジュールを使用する

Apache 構成ファイルで対応する PHP モジュール (mod_php など) を見つけ、モジュール情報を必要な PHP バージョンに変更し、保存して Apache (バージョン) を再起動します。切り替えを完了することができます。

3.3 FastCGI の使用

FastCGI を使用すると、Web サーバー上で複数の PHP バージョンを同時にサポートできます。 FastCGI 構成ファイルに PHP 実行可能ファイルへのパスを指定して、バージョンの切り替えを完了します。

PHP バージョンを変更する方法は上記の 3 つです。バージョンを切り替える場合は、現在のシステムの安定性と既存のアプリケーションへの影響に注意する必要があります。

さらに、PHP バージョンの切り替えには、関連コンポーネントや PHP 拡張機能を備えたサードパーティ アプリケーション サーバーなどが関係する可能性があることに注意してください。したがって、バージョンを切り替える前に、データの損失やその他の予期せぬ問題を避けるために、関連するファイルとデータを事前にバックアップする必要があります。

つまり、PHP のバージョンを変更するのは少し面倒ですが、上記の手順に従っていただければ、必要な PHP のバージョンに正常に切り替えることができると思います。

以上がPHPのバージョンを変更する方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。